[QUOTE="Biggs300, post: 676070, member: 31342"] Daveinjax, good choice! I think the larger Longhunter will serve you well. I use my Longhunter Standard (38" waist and 21" torso length) mostly for deer hunting when I'm out for a couple of days. They are well made and the guys at Kifaru will provide a pack with a custom fit. I have two packs; the Kifaru and an Eberlestock J-34 pack. Between the two, I'm covered for just about any hunting situation I'm likely to come across. [/QUOTE]
